When the kernel is booted without the 'clk_ignore_unused' and
'pd_ignore_unused' command‑line flags, votes for unused clocks and power
domains are dropped by the kernel post late_init and deferred probe
timeout. Depending on the relative timing between the ICE probe and the
kernel disabling the unused clocks and power domains occasional unclocked
register accesses or 'stuck' clocks are observed during QCOM‑ICE probe.
When the 'iface' clock is not voted on, unclocked register access would
be observed. On the other hand, if the associated power-domain for ICE
is not enabled, a 'stuck' clock is observed.

This patch series resolves both of these problems by adding explicit
power‑domain enablement and 'iface' clock‑vote handling to the QCOM‑ICE
driver.

The clock 'stuck' issue was first reported on Qualcomm RideSX4 (sa8775p)
platform: https://lore.kernel.org/all/ZZYTYsaNUuWQg3tR@x1/

Issue with unclocked ICE register access is easily reproducible on
on Qualcomm RB3Gen2 (kodiak) platform when 'clk_ignore_unused' is
not passed on the kernel command-line.

This patch series has been validated on: SM8650-MTP, RB3Gen2 and
Lemans-EVK.

The DT bindings for inline-crypto engine do not specify the UFS_PHY_GDSC
power-domain and iface clock. Without enabling the iface clock and the
associated power-domain the ICE hardware cannot function correctly and
leads to unclocked hardware accesses being observed during probe.

Fix the DT bindings for inline-crypto engine to require the UFS_PHY_GDSC
power-domain and iface clock for new devices (Eliza and Milos) introduced
in the current release (7.0) with yet-to-stabilize ABI, while preserving
backward compatibility for older devices.

Since Qualcomm inline-crypto engine (ICE) is now a dedicated driver
de-coupled from the QCOM UFS driver, it explicitly votes for its required
clocks during probe. For scenarios where the 'clk_ignore_unused' flag is
not passed on the kernel command line, to avoid potential unclocked ICE
hardware register access during probe the ICE driver should additionally
vote on the 'iface' clock.
Also update the suspend and resume callbacks to handle un-voting and voting
on the 'iface' clock.

Qualcomm in-line crypto engine (ICE) platform driver specifies and votes
for its own resources. Before accessing ICE hardware during probe, to
avoid potential unclocked register access issues (when clk_ignore_unused
is not passed on the kernel command line), in addition to the 'core' clock
the 'iface' clock should also be turned on by the driver. This can only be
done if the GCC_UFS_PHY_GDSC power domain is enabled. Specify both the
GCC_UFS_PHY_GDSC power domain and the 'iface' clock in the ICE node for
kaanapali.
